What does certified humane mean for beef?

The Certified Humane Raised and Handled® logo assures consumers that: The producer meets our Animal Care Standards and applies them to farm animals, from birth through slaughter. Animals are never kept in cages, crates, or tie stalls. Animals must be free to do what comes naturally.

Is animal welfare certified halal?

Halal is Arabic for “permissible” and certification requirements focus only on how animals are slaughtered and by whom. In fact, only one of the many agencies that certifies halal slaughter practices in the U.S. pays explicit attention to animal welfare during the course of an animal’s life.

Is certified humane better than organic?

The main difference between the certifications is that organic standards are environment based and certified humane standards are animal-welfare based.

What does Certified Humane mean on meat?

Meat, dairy and eggs that feature the Certified Humane label come from animals that were never housed in cages, crates or tie stalls. Animals are given space to engage in their natural behaviors (such as perching for laying hens and rooting for pigs).

What is Certified Animal Welfare approved by AGW?

Acknowledged by Consumer Reports as the only “highly meaningful” food label for farm animal welfare, outdoor access and sustainability, Certified Animal Welfare Approved by AGW (AWA) is an independent, nonprofit farm certification program—and now one of the nation’s top 5 fastest growing certifications and label claims.
